The Twelfth Juror
Originally released in 1913. The Twelfth Juror is a drama film. directed by George Lessey. At just 10 minutes, it's a tight, focused story.
Starring Ben F. Wilson, Laura Sawyer, and Jack Conway
Synopsis
A play based on a famous English case of a man being executed wrongfully on circumstantial evidence.
